the way I understand the chain of events is,

1. the FBI was conducting an investigation into Weiner sexting a minor

2. in the course of the investigation, they uncovered emails sent to Hillary's private server from a device owned by either Huma or Weiner

3. as these emails are relevant to the earliest HRC investigation, they were required to notify Congress and the new emails are being reviewed


there's no indication thus far that the emails contained classified information, but they may have been part of the emails that Hillary flagged as "personal" and deleted.
